Keating Investment Counselors Inc. lowered its position in Equinor ASA (NYSE:EQNR - Free Report) by 12.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 259,060 shares of the company's stock after selling 36,978 shares during the period. Equinor ASA accounts for about 1.9% of Keating Investment Counselors Inc.'s investment portfolio, making the stock its 12th largest holding. Keating Investment Counselors Inc.'s holdings in Equinor ASA were worth $6,137,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Equinor ASA Announces Dividend
The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, February 28th. Stockholders of record on Friday, February 14th will be given a dividend of $0.35 per share. This represents a $1.40 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 6.03%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, February 14th. Equinor ASA's payout ratio is currently 37.62%.

Equinor ASA Company Profile

Equinor ASA, an energy company, engages in the exploration, production, transportation, refining, and marketing of petroleum and other forms of energy in Norway and internationally. It operates through Exploration & Production Norway; Exploration & Production International; Exploration & Production USA; Marketing, Midstream & Processing; Renewables; and Other segments.
